Abstract

            This article explores innovative pedagogical strategies aimed at enhancing students’ functional literacy through the integration of Olympiad-level mathematical and scientific problems into the school curriculum. The study analyzes how complex, non-standard problems can stimulate analytical thinking, promote interdisciplinary learning, and develop key competencies such as problem-solving, interpretation of data, and mathematical reasoning. The paper presents theoretical foundations and outlines practical models implemented in real classroom settings. Results suggest that incorporating Olympiad-level tasks in a structured and scaffolded manner significantly improves students’ ability to apply knowledge in real-life contexts.
